如何加快主页打开速度

加快主页打开速度,首先优化图片大小和格式,使用压缩工具减少文件体积。其次,启用浏览器缓存,减少重复加载。再利用CDN加速内容分发,提升访问速度。最后,精简HTML、CSS和JavaScript代码,移除不必要的插件和脚本。

imagesource from: pexels

引言标题:主页打开速度:用户体验与SEO的黄金法则

在当今快节奏的网络时代,主页打开速度已成为衡量网站质量的重要标准。它不仅直接影响用户体验,更与搜索引擎优化(SEO)息息相关。本文将深入探讨主页打开速度的重要性,并提供实用的优化方法,旨在激发您进一步探索如何提升网站性能的兴趣。

一、优化图片大小和格式

在当今的互联网时代,图片在网站中扮演着至关重要的角色。它们不仅能够丰富网站内容,还能够提高用户的阅读体验。然而,图片文件体积过大往往会成为主页加载速度的瓶颈。因此,优化图片大小和格式成为加快主页打开速度的关键步骤。

1. 选择合适的图片格式

不同的图片格式具有不同的特点。例如,JPEG格式适合用于复杂的图片,而PNG格式则适合用于简单且需要透明背景的图片。在选择图片格式时,应考虑以下因素:

  • 文件大小:不同格式的图片,其文件大小会有所不同。通常,JPEG格式文件比PNG格式文件更小。
  • 图像质量:JPEG格式在压缩过程中可能会损失一些图像质量,而PNG格式则能够保持更高的图像质量。
  • 使用场景:根据图片的使用场景选择合适的格式。例如,产品图片适合使用JPEG格式,而图标和徽标适合使用PNG格式。

2. 使用图片压缩工具

为了进一步减小图片文件体积,可以使用图片压缩工具。以下是一些常用的图片压缩工具:

  • 在线工具:例如,TinyPNG、ImageOptim等,它们能够自动压缩图片,并保持较高的图像质量。
  • 桌面软件:例如,Photoshop、GIMP等,它们提供更丰富的压缩选项,但操作相对复杂。

3. 懒加载技术的应用

懒加载技术是指按需加载图片,即只有当用户滚动到图片位置时,才加载并显示图片。这种技术可以有效减少初次加载的图片数量,从而加快主页打开速度。以下是一些实现懒加载的方法:

  • 原生JavaScript:使用JavaScript代码监听滚动事件,并在图片进入视口时加载图片。
  • 库和框架:例如,LazyLoad.js、InfinityScroll等,它们提供更简洁、高效的懒加载解决方案。

通过以上方法,可以有效地优化图片大小和格式,从而加快主页打开速度,提升用户体验。

二、启用浏览器缓存

在现代互联网环境中,主页打开速度不仅影响用户体验,更直接关系到网站的SEO排名。其中,启用浏览器缓存是一种简单而有效的优化手段。

1. 缓存策略的设置

缓存策略是指浏览器如何处理页面的资源。合理的缓存策略可以显著提升页面加载速度。以下是一些设置缓存策略的常用方法:

  • 设置缓存时长:根据页面内容的更新频率,合理设置缓存的时长。对于更新频率较低的内容,可以设置较长的缓存时长;对于更新频率较高的内容,则应设置较短的缓存时长。
  • 使用缓存控制头:通过HTTP头信息,控制浏览器对特定资源的缓存行为。如Cache-Control头可用于设置缓存时长、是否允许缓存等。

2. 缓存控制头的使用

缓存控制头是HTTP响应头的一部分,主要用于控制浏览器的缓存行为。以下是一些常用的缓存控制头:

  • Cache-Control:设置缓存时长、是否允许缓存等。
  • ETag:用于验证缓存的 freshness,即缓存内容是否已过期。
  • Last-Modified:记录资源最后修改时间,用于判断缓存内容是否需要更新。

3. 常见缓存问题的解决

在实际操作中,可能会遇到以下缓存问题:

  • 缓存未命中:当用户请求的资源未被缓存时,服务器需要重新生成该资源,导致加载速度变慢。解决方法:优化缓存策略,提高缓存命中率。
  • 缓存污染:当缓存内容被篡改或篡改后未被更新时,会导致用户看到错误或过时的信息。解决方法:定期清理缓存,或使用更严格的缓存控制策略。

通过启用浏览器缓存,可以有效提升主页打开速度,为用户提供更好的用户体验。

三、利用CDN加速内容分发

1、CDN的基本原理

CDN(内容分发网络)是一种通过在全球多个节点部署服务器来加速内容分发的技术。它通过将内容缓存在距离用户最近的节点上,从而减少数据传输的距离和时间,提升用户体验和网站性能。CDN的基本原理可以概括为以下几点:

  • 边缘计算:CDN节点位于网络边缘,靠近用户,可以快速响应用户请求。
  • 内容缓存:CDN将热门内容缓存到节点上,当用户请求这些内容时,可以直接从节点获取,无需访问原始服务器。
  • 负载均衡:CDN可以根据用户请求的地理位置,智能地将请求分发到最近的节点,提高访问速度。

2、选择合适的CDN服务商

选择合适的CDN服务商对于网站性能和用户体验至关重要。以下是一些选择CDN服务商时需要考虑的因素:

  • 节点分布:选择节点分布广泛、覆盖全球的CDN服务商,可以确保内容分发速度。
  • 带宽和性能:选择带宽充足、性能稳定的CDN服务商,可以保证网站访问速度。
  • 价格和性价比:比较不同CDN服务商的价格和性价比,选择最合适的方案。
  • 技术支持:选择提供优质技术支持的服务商,以便在遇到问题时及时解决。

3、CDN配置与优化

配置和优化CDN可以进一步提升网站性能。以下是一些常见的CDN配置和优化方法:

  • 域名解析:将网站域名解析到CDN节点,以便用户访问时直接从CDN获取内容。
  • 缓存规则:设置合理的缓存规则,例如缓存时间、缓存路径等,以提高内容分发效率。
  • SSL加速:使用SSL证书为网站提供安全访问,并利用CDN的SSL加速功能提高访问速度。
  • 缓存预热:在CDN节点上预热热门内容,加快用户访问速度。
  • 缓存清理:定期清理CDN缓存,确保内容更新及时。

通过以上方法,可以有效利用CDN加速内容分发,提升网站性能和用户体验。

四、精简HTML、CSS和JavaScript代码

在现代网页设计中,HTML、CSS和JavaScript代码的复杂性日益增加,这虽然带来了丰富的用户体验,但也导致了主页打开速度的下降。因此,精简这些代码是加快主页打开速度的关键步骤。

1. 代码压缩与合并

代码压缩是一种通过移除不必要的空格、注释和换行符来减小代码文件大小的技术。这可以通过使用在线工具或构建工具如Gulp、Webpack等实现。此外,将多个CSS和JavaScript文件合并为一个文件可以减少HTTP请求的数量,进一步加快页面加载速度。

代码类型 压缩前大小 压缩后大小 压缩比例
CSS 100KB 50KB 50%
JS 200KB 100KB 50%

2. 移除不必要的插件和脚本

许多网站为了实现各种功能而引入了大量的插件和脚本。然而,这些插件和脚本可能并不总是被使用,或者存在冗余。因此,定期检查并移除不必要的服务可以减少页面加载时间。

3. 优化代码结构

良好的代码结构可以提升网站的性能。例如,将CSS样式和JavaScript脚本放在HTML文件的底部可以减少渲染阻塞。同时,利用浏览器缓存可以存储某些资源,减少重复加载,从而加快页面加载速度。

总结来说,精简HTML、CSS和JavaScript代码是加快主页打开速度的重要手段。通过代码压缩、移除不必要的插件和脚本以及优化代码结构,可以显著提升用户体验和SEO排名。

结语

通过本文的详细探讨,我们了解到了加快主页打开速度的多种实用方法。从优化图片大小和格式,到启用浏览器缓存、利用CDN加速内容分发,再到精简HTML、CSS和JavaScript代码,每个环节都至关重要。这些技巧的综合应用,将显著提升用户体验,并优化SEO排名。不要犹豫,立即采取行动,让你的主页加载速度飞快如风!

常见问题

  1. 优化图片会不会影响画质?优化图片并不意味着牺牲画质。通过选择合适的图片格式,如JPEG或PNG,并根据需要调整图片尺寸,可以在不影响视觉效果的情况下显著减小文件大小。使用图片压缩工具可以在不显著降低图片质量的前提下进一步减小文件大小。

  2. 浏览器缓存如何设置最有效?设置浏览器缓存的最有效方法是合理配置缓存策略。这包括为静态资源设置较长的缓存时间,以及使用合适的缓存控制头。同时,要注意缓存内容的更新,确保用户始终获取最新的数据。

  3. CDN加速是否适用于所有网站?CDN(内容分发网络)加速技术适用于几乎所有的网站。特别是对于访问量较大、用户分布广泛的网站,CDN可以帮助提升访问速度,减少延迟,提高用户体验。

  4. 精简代码会不会影响网站功能?精简代码时,应该谨慎移除不必要的插件和脚本。通过优化代码结构和移除冗余代码,可以在不影响网站功能的前提下,显著提高网站性能。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/70383.html

Like (0)
路飞SEO的头像路飞SEO编辑
Previous 2025-06-13 08:50
Next 2025-06-13 08:50

相关推荐

  • vps空间是什么

    VPS空间,即虚拟专用服务器空间,是一种通过虚拟化技术将物理服务器分割成多个独立虚拟服务器的解决方案。每个VPS拥有独立的操作系统、内存、硬盘和IP地址,用户可以完全控制其环境和资源。VPS空间适用于需要高灵活性、稳定性和安全性的网站或应用,特别适合中小企业和个人开发者。

  • 如何更好经营外贸网

    经营外贸网需注重市场调研,了解目标市场的需求和偏好。优化网站SEO,提升搜索引擎排名。利用社交媒体和电子邮件营销吸引潜在客户。提供多语言支持,确保用户体验良好。定期分析数据,调整策略,提升转化率。

    2025-06-14
    0133
  • 网页中多少个关键字

    网页中的关键词数量应根据内容自然分布,一般建议每篇300-500字的文案中包含3-5个关键词。过多堆砌关键词可能导致搜索引擎惩罚,影响用户体验。合理布局,确保关键词与内容相关,有助于提升SEO效果。

    2025-06-11
    00
  • 网站到期后续费多少钱

    网站到期后续费费用因服务商和套餐不同而有所差异。一般基础套餐续费在100-500元/年,包含域名和主机服务。若需升级功能或增加存储空间,费用会相应增加。建议提前与服务商确认具体续费价格,避免因逾期产生额外费用。

    2025-06-11
    01
  • 如何建模板网站

    建模板网站首先选择合适的网站建设平台,如WordPress、Wix等。挑选符合需求的模板,确保设计简洁、响应式。上传自定义内容,包括文字、图片和视频。优化SEO设置,如标题、描述和关键词。最后,进行测试并发布,确保网站流畅且易于导航。

  • 亚航科技能开多少

    亚航科技作为一家新兴科技公司,其薪资水平因岗位、经验和地区而异。一般来说,初级岗位年薪在10-15万元,中级岗位在15-25万元,高级岗位可达30万元以上。具体薪资还需结合个人能力和市场行情。

    2025-06-11
    00
  • ps素描字体效果怎么做

    要实现PS素描字体效果,首先在Photoshop中创建新图层并输入文字。然后,右键点击文字图层选择‘栅格化文字’。接着,使用‘滤镜’菜单中的‘素描’选项,选择‘炭笔’或‘ Conte 色粉笔’效果。调整参数至满意效果,最后可添加背景纹理增强立体感。

    2025-06-16
    095
  • 网站布局有什么

    网站布局是影响用户体验和SEO效果的关键因素。合理的布局可以提高页面加载速度,优化导航结构,使内容更易于浏览和理解。常见的布局包括F型、Z型等,应根据内容类型和用户行为选择。同时,确保移动端适配和响应式设计,以提升跨设备访问体验。

    2025-06-19
    089
  • 织梦怎么调用友情链接

    织梦调用友情链接很简单。首先,登录后台进入模板管理,找到需要添加友情链接的模板文件。接着,在合适位置插入代码:{dede:flink row='10' titlelen='20' type='text'}[/dede:flink]。其中,row控制链接数量,titlelen控制标题长度。保存后,前端即可显示友情链接。

    2025-06-16
    0190

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注